Summary
After public comment and committee discussion recalling the 2020 measure fight, the Charter Review Committee voted to remove from its active list an item that would have granted the county executive officer full hiring/firing authority over appointed department heads without board confirmation.
The Charter Review Committee debated whether to pursue a charter amendment that would expand the county executive officer’s authority to appoint, suspend or remove appointed department heads without board confirmation.
